Jane Austen steps out of the autumn of 1815 to visit you at the most vibrant and hopeful time of her life. Her first three novels — Sense and Sensibility, Pride and Prejudice, and Mansfield Park — have charmed the public, and Emma is complete. 

In this captivating 45-minute performance, drawn from her letters, juvenilia, and novels, Jane shares warm, witty, and heartfelt stories of her childhood in Steventon, her cherished sister Cassandra, her dazzling cousin Eliza, her inspiring mentor Madame LeFroy, and the loves and losses that shaped her heart and her pen. 

Whether you are a casual reader or a devoted “Janeite,” you’ll enjoy a rare, personal glimpse of Jane Austen as both the woman and the writer - followed by an open Q&A.
